Studying Online at Rutgers University-New Brunswick
Many students take online classes at Rutgers University-New Brunswick. Among 52,269 students, 3,953 (8%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 21,737 (42%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Landscape Architecture Graduates from Rutgers University-New Brunswick
Graduates of Rutgers University-New Brunswick’s Landscape Architecture program earn the following amounts (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):
| Years After Graduation | Median Earnings |
|---|---|
| 1 year | $38,244 |
| 2 years | $52,107 |
Median Debt at Graduation
Typical debt at graduation for Landscape Architecture graduates from Rutgers University-New Brunswick comes in at $27,000.
Student Demographics & Diversity
The following sections describe the diversity of Landscape Architecture graduates at Rutgers University-New Brunswick, broken down by degree level.
Program-wide, Landscape Architecture graduates at Rutgers University-New Brunswick are 45% women (9) and 55% men (11).
Landscape Architecture Bachelor’s Program at Rutgers University-New Brunswick
Among the 14 bachelor’s landscape architecture degrees awarded at Rutgers University-New Brunswick, 36% were women (5) and 64% were men (9).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Landscape Architecture bachelor’s degree recipients at Rutgers University-New Brunswick.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 3 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 8 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
| International (Nonresident) | 1 |
| Unknown | 1 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 64% of Landscape Architecture bachelor’s degree recipients at Rutgers University-New Brunswick, higher than the national average of 36%.*
